The State of Georgia holds title to, and the Georgia Department of Corrections is the custodian of, approximately 20.31 acres of real property in Land Lot 18 of the 3rd District of Terrell County, in the city of Dawson, Georgia, (hereinafter the “Premises”), as depicted in that survey attached hereto as Exhibit A and incorporated herein by reference; and The Premises was conveyed by the Terrell County Board of Commissioners on August 7, 1998; and The Premises was acquired for the purposes of constructing and operating a Probation Detention Center; and The Georgia Board of Corrections, at its meeting on February 7, 2013, acknowledged the discontinued use of the Premises and resolved to approve transfer of custody and control of the Premises to the Georgia Department of Juvenile Justice; and The Georgia Board of Juvenile Justice‘, at its meeting on February 21, 2013, expressed its desire for custody and control of the Premises to operate a regional youth detention center and resolved to accept the custody of the Premises from the Georgia Department of Corrections. Now, THEREFORE, PURSUANT To THE AUTHORITY VESTED IN ME AS GOVERNOR OF THE STATE OF GEORGIA, IT IS HEREBY That custody of the above—defined Premises located in Terrell County, Georgia be and the same is hereby transferred to the Georgia Department of Juvenile Justice from the Georgia Department of Corrections.
